    Measure the temperature of cylinders, pipes, and flat surfaces without installing an immersion probe and where a point sensor may be inaccurate. These RTD probes take multiple temperatures along the length of the probe and average them together for accuracy. About the thickness of a dime, they stick to surfaces in tight spaces.
